+/* tries to send <nmsg> message parts from message array <msg> to sink <sink>.
+ * Formatting according to the sink's preference is done here, unless sink->fmt
+ * is unspecified, in which case the caller formatting will be used instead.
+ *
+ * It will stop writing at <maxlen> instead of sink->maxlen if <maxlen> is
+ * positive and inferior to sink->maxlen.
+ *
+ * Lost messages are accounted for in the sink's counter. If there
+ * were lost messages, an attempt is first made to indicate it.
+ * The function returns the number of Bytes effectively sent or announced.
+ * or <= 0 in other cases.
+ */
+static inline ssize_t sink_write(struct sink *sink, struct log_header hdr,
+ size_t maxlen, const struct ist msg[], size_t nmsg)
+{
+ ssize_t sent;
+
+ if (unlikely(sink->ctx.dropped > 0)) {
+ /* We need to take an exclusive lock so that other producers
+ * don't do the same thing at the same time and above all we
+ * want to be sure others have finished sending their messages
+ * so that the dropped event arrives exactly at the right
+ * position.
+ */
+ HA_RWLOCK_WRLOCK(RING_LOCK, &sink->ctx.lock);
+ sent = sink_announce_dropped(sink, hdr);
+ HA_RWLOCK_WRUNLOCK(RING_LOCK, &sink->ctx.lock);
+
+ if (!sent) {
+ /* we failed, we don't try to send our log as if it
+ * would pass by chance, we'd get disordered events.
+ */
+ goto fail;
+ }
+ }
+
+ HA_RWLOCK_RDLOCK(RING_LOCK, &sink->ctx.lock);
+ sent = __sink_write(sink, hdr, maxlen, msg, nmsg);
+ HA_RWLOCK_RDUNLOCK(RING_LOCK, &sink->ctx.lock);
+
+ fail:
+ if (unlikely(sent <= 0))
+ HA_ATOMIC_INC(&sink->ctx.dropped);
+
+ return sent;
+}
